Best Schools in Condon, MT
Condon, MT has a total of 14 schools including 4 high schools, 6 middle schools and 4 elementary schools. A total of 2,772 students attend Condon, MT schools. On average, schools in Condon score 33% on their proficiency tests, and we project an average score of 37%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, schools in Condon don't meet exp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in Condon, MT
City-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.
Community Factors
Condon, MT has a total population of 434 with 8%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 98%, and 47%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
